Tidal flats of Saga in February

 The time was a bit off. High tide at 11am is not very high and a little late for good lighting. Many images were back-lit. It's just a recording of what was there and of what I wanted to see.


Saunders's Gulls, ズグロカモメ in flight



mixed with Dunlins, ハマシギ



The 2 Oystercatchers, ミヤコドリ that stayed for the winter





Many Curlews, mostly Eurasian, ダイシャクシギ and a Bar-tailed Godwit, オオソリハシシギ







One Far-Eastern Curlew, ホウロクシギ on the right



The 2 smaller birds are Long-billed Dowitchers, オオハシシギ



Then there was a Red Knot, コオバシギ in winter plumage, among all the Grey Plovers, ダイセン





Another Godwit: Black-tailed, オグロシギ



Eurasian Spoonbills, ヘラシギ in the creek
